Student identifies disability
30 pts

as well as strengths and weaknesses

Poor

Student does not identify their disability or strengths and weaknesses
Fair

Student identifies their disability, but not strengths or weaknesses
Good

Student identifies their disability and provides a full explanation of their strengths and weaknesses
Student is able to provide
30 pts

an explanation about accommodations and/or modifications needed

Poor

Student does not know what accommodations and/or modifications he/she receives nor acknowledges reasons for them.
Fair

Student states accommodations and/or modifications, but can not provide reasons for having them
Good

Student is able to state accommodations and/or modifications with an explanation of why he/she is receiving them.
Student is able to communicate
40 pts

needs or accommodations to appropriate person

Poor

Student is unable to communicate needs to appropriate person.
Fair

Student is able to state accommodations, but unable to when needed
Good

Student is able to fully explain accommodations and needs to appropriate person.
